Description Of Issue
Can’t find Roon Core - but …

When I turn on my Win10 PC which works as my Roon Core and I use my Roon Remote App on my One+ Android it can’t find my core. BUT, if I turn OFF “Remote” in Roon settings and turn it ON again right away my phone/remote will find my core right away.

It works like that every time and wont work with Roon Remote on any other way. No problems finding my KEF LS50 Wireless speakers on the core with or without the remote active.

I think I found a way on how to make it work without entering the Settings->Setup function.

If I start my Roon Remote up FIRST and then my Roon Core SECOND that seems to fix the issue.
